NEW ORLEANS (AP) — Loyola University officials have laid off 18 staff members and announced that 12 non-tenured faculty will not have their contracts renewed in April.
The New Orleans Advocate reports (http://bit.ly/1dy4tgA ) that the university is trying to erase a $5.1 million deficit in its budget.
The layoffs come as the university has been trimming its budget in light of a significant drop in enrollment this year, the second year in a row Loyola has seen its enrollment numbers decline.
